1 hour ago, HKSR said:

In the 14 games where DeSmith and Silovs played while Demko was injured, Canucks had a:

 

2.85 GAA

0.884 Sv%

 

DeSmith and Silov's stats this regular season:

 

DeSmith:  2.89 GAA, 0.895 Sv%

Silovs:  2.47 GAA, 0.881 Sv%

 

 

In the 3 games Demko has been back, Canucks have a:

 

2.33 GAA

0.920 Sv%

 

Demko's record this regular season:

 

2.45 GAA

0.918 Sv%

 

Let's not kid ourselves.  The goalie is on the ice for 60min per game.  This is a huge blow to our chances. 

 

The team also plays differently with Demko in net.  More aggressive, and they push the play more.  Unless Petey comes alive, we're gonna be in tough, even against this Nashville team.
